Bellevue House, An Elegant Detached 3 Storey Home
Welcome to Bellevue House, a gorgeous three-storey detached period home located in the coastal town of Cowes. This charming home seamlessly blends historic features with modern comfort, offering a unique living experience with much character.
Ground Floor
As you approach the property, the charming Victorian tiled pathway leads you to an inviting entrance, surrounded with a pretty cottage style garden.
Stepping inside, you are greeted by a lovely entranceway, in an 'orangery' style with shelves for plants and other bits and bobs. A further door opens to the hallway with deep skirting boards and beautiful stripped floorboards that continue throughout the ground floor rooms. There is a handy cloakroom and multiple living areas, including a spacious formal sitting room with an ornate fireplace, picture rails and large sash windows and a beautiful dining room with doors that open to the garden and an original understairs drinks cupboard/pantry. The dining room, adjacent to the living room, is a cosy family room perfect for relaxed evenings.
The kitchen, leading off the dining room, is light and airy with dual aspect windows with a 'Velux' and stable style door opening to the delightful garden. It is equipped with a good range of units, with space and plumbing for dishwasher, washing machine and tall fridge/freezer.
First Floor
On the first floor, you will find a generous double bedroom and a single bedroom used as an office. The double bedroom is a serene retreat with an original fireplace and large sash windows to the front. The family bathroom on this floor is equipped with both a freestanding bathtub with overhead shower.
Top Floor
The second floor offers two more double bedrooms, one with an ensuite, - this bedroom with glorious far reaching views of the sea across the rooftops. Both rooms on this floor further retains the historic character of the home with original fireplaces.
Exterior
The mature walled garden is a peaceful oasis, with its vibrant flower beds, matures shrubs, plum tree and grape vine that winds around one of the variety of seating zones. A perfect area for enjoying the surroundings. There is a terrace adjacent to the kitchen and dining room for dining outside on warm days, a pretty garden store and very useful gated side access. Within this quiet space is the original well that still works via the hand pump, a more modern tap is also available for garden uses.
Cowes
Bellevue House is ideally located in Cowes, a town renowned for its sailing heritage and vibrant maritime community. The property is within walking distance of local amenities, including boutique shops, cafes, and restaurants. The nearby 'Redjet' passenger ferry terminal offers excellent transport links to the mainland, making commuting or weekend getaways convenient.
Further Information
Tenure: Freehold
EPC: D
Gas Central Heating
Services include electric, gas, water
Council tax band: C
Under the current owners tenure, the chimneys have been rebuilt so fireplaces can be used
The property has been rewired, replumbed and repointed plus some new windows installed
